Key Factors Influencing Your 2026 Sea Freight Quote

Market volatility continues to play a major role in how ocean freight rates are calculated daily. While the disruptions of 2025 have largely stabilized, seasonal demand during the Q3 peak season still causes prices to rise by 15-25%. Accordingly, savvy shippers use online tools to monitor these trends and book shipments during off-peak windows whenever possible.

Fuel surcharges, often referred to as BAF (Bunker Adjustment Factor), remain a variable component of every quote. Because global energy prices fluctuate, these surcharges are updated monthly or even weekly by major carriers. Nevertheless, getting a quote online ensures that these adjustments are automatically included in your final estimate.

Port congestion and equipment availability also impact the rates you see on your screen. For example, a shortage of 40HQ containers in North China ports might lead to a temporary premium on those specific units. To summarize, your quote is a snapshot of the current supply and demand balance within the global shipping network.

How Does Sea Freight Compare to Other Shipping Options?

Comparing different transport modes is essential for optimizing your supply chain budget and delivery schedule. While sea freight offers the lowest cost per unit, it also requires the longest lead times compared to other methods. On the other hand, air freight provides unmatched speed but at a significantly higher price point.

Inland alternatives like rail freight have become increasingly popular for shipments between China and Europe. Rail serves as a middle ground, offering faster transit than ships and lower costs than planes. However, rail is not an option for island nations or trans-pacific routes, where maritime transport remains the dominant force.

Hybrid solutions, such as sea-air combinations, are gaining traction in 2026 for urgent but budget-conscious shipments. These strategies involve shipping by sea to a hub like Dubai or Singapore and then flying the cargo to the final destination. Without a doubt, choosing the right mode depends entirely on your specific cargo value and deadline requirements.

FCL vs LCL: Which Sea Freight Quote Should You Choose?

Full Container Load (FCL) shipping is generally the most cost-effective choice for shipments exceeding 15 cubic meters. When you book an FCL, you pay for the entire container, providing better security and faster handling at the port. Consequently, businesses with high-volume inventory often prefer this method to minimize the risk of damage from other shippers’ cargo.

Less than Container Load (LCL) is the ideal alternative for smaller shipments that do not fill a whole container. In this scenario, your goods share space with other shipments, and you only pay for the volume you occupy. Although LCL is more flexible for small businesses, it typically involves longer transit times due to the consolidation and deconsolidation processes.

Deciding between these two depends on your volume thresholds and inventory turnover needs. For instance, if you are shipping 12 CBM of electronics, an LCL quote might seem cheaper, but an FCL 20GP container could offer better protection. Therefore, you should always get sea freight quote online for both options to see where the price break occurs.

Navigating Customs and Documentation for Sea Freight

Securing a freight quote is only half the battle; ensuring your paperwork is in order is equally vital. Professional customs brokerage services help prevent costly delays at the border by verifying HS codes and duty rates. Furthermore, accurate documentation like the Bill of Lading and Commercial Invoice must match your online quote details exactly.

Digital platforms in 2026 now integrate customs filing directly into the booking workflow. This automation reduces the likelihood of manual entry errors that often lead to port storage fees or ‘demurrage’. Additionally, being aware of specific country regulations, such as timber treatment requirements for Australia, is essential for a smooth delivery.

Insurance should never be overlooked when reviewing your sea freight quote online. While carriers have limited liability, third-party cargo insurance provides full coverage against maritime perils or theft. In contrast to the low cost of premiums, the peace of mind offered during a 40-day transit is invaluable for any business owner.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does it take to get sea freight quote online?
Most digital platforms provide instant quotes for standard routes. For specialized cargo or complex door-to-door requirements, a verified quote typically takes less than 24 hours.
Are online sea freight quotes accurate?
Yes, online quotes are highly accurate as they pull data directly from carrier systems. However, they are usually subject to final weight and dimension verification after loading.
What information do I need for a sea freight quote?
You need the origin and destination ports, cargo weight, total volume in CBM, and the type of goods. Specifying FCL or LCL is also mandatory for an accurate estimate.
Does a sea freight quote include customs duties?
Generally, freight quotes cover transport and port fees but exclude government duties and taxes. You should request a separate customs estimate for total landed cost calculation.
Can I lock in a sea freight rate online?
Many platforms allow you to lock in a rate for 48-72 hours. To secure the price for a longer period, you must complete the booking and provide a shipping instruction.
Why do sea freight quotes change frequently?
Rates fluctuate due to fuel price changes, carrier capacity, and seasonal demand. Digital quotes reflect these real-time market shifts to ensure you get current pricing.
Is insurance included in the online quote?
Basic carrier liability is included, but comprehensive cargo insurance is usually an optional add-on. We strongly recommend adding it to protect against unforeseen maritime risks.
What is the difference between port-to-port and door-to-door quotes?
Port-to-port only covers the sea journey between two docks. Door-to-door includes inland trucking, customs clearance, and final delivery to your warehouse.
